linux通过命令配置ip

fiy 其他 8

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以通过命令行来配置IP地址。下面是配置IP地址的步骤:

    1. 查看网卡接口:使用命令 `ifconfig -a` 或 `ip addr show` 可以列出当前系统中的网卡接口信息。选择要配置的网卡接口。

    2. 关闭网卡接口:使用命令 `sudo ifdown ` 关闭要配置的网卡接口。例如,要关闭eth0网卡,可以执行 `sudo ifdown eth0`。

    3. 配置IP地址:使用命令 `sudo ifconfig netmask ` 配置IP地址和子网掩码。例如,要将eth0网卡的IP地址设置为192.168.1.100,子网掩码为255.255.255.0,可以执行 `sudo ifconfig eth0 192.168.1.100 netmask 255.255.255.0`。

    4. 打开网卡接口:使用命令 `sudo ifup ` 打开刚刚配置的网卡接口。例如,要打开eth0网卡,可以执行 `sudo ifup eth0`。

    5. 验证配置:使用命令 `ifconfig` 或 `ip addr show` 再次查看网卡接口信息,确保配置正确生效。

    除了使用ifconfig命令,您还可以使用ip命令来配置IP地址。使用ip命令配置IP地址的步骤如下:

    1. 查看网卡接口:使用命令 `ip link show` 或 `ip addr show` 可以列出当前系统中的网卡接口信息。选择要配置的网卡接口。

    2. 关闭网卡接口:使用命令 `sudo ip link set down` 关闭要配置的网卡接口。例如,要关闭eth0网卡,可以执行 `sudo ip link set eth0 down`。

    3. 配置IP地址:使用命令 `sudo ip addr add / dev ` 配置IP地址和子网掩码。例如,要将eth0网卡的IP地址设置为192.168.1.100,子网掩码为255.255.255.0,可以执行 `sudo ip addr add 192.168.1.100/24 dev eth0`。

    4. 打开网卡接口:使用命令 `sudo ip link set up` 打开刚刚配置的网卡接口。例如,要打开eth0网卡,可以执行 `sudo ip link set eth0 up`。

    5. 验证配置:使用命令 `ip addr show` 再次查看网卡接口信息,确保配置正确生效。

    请注意,上述命令中的 `` 是指网卡接口的名称,例如eth0、ens33等。而 `` 是要设置的IP地址,`` 是子网掩码的位数或具体数值。

    配置完成后,您可以使用ping命令或其他网络工具来测试网络连接。希望这些步骤能够帮助您成功配置Linux系统的IP地址。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,可以通过命令行配置IP地址。以下是在Linux中配置IP地址的一般步骤:

    1. 检查网络接口:使用`ifconfig`命令或`ip addr`命令来查看当前网络接口信息。确定要配置的网络接口名称。

    2. 关闭网络接口:使用`ifdown`命令或`ifconfig`命令来关闭要配置的网络接口,例如`ifdown eth0`。

    3. 配置IP地址:使用`ifconfig`命令或`ip addr add`命令来配置IP地址,例如`ifconfig eth0 192.168.0.100 netmask 255.255.255.0`或`ip addr add 192.168.0.100/24 dev eth0`。其中,将`192.168.0.100`替换为要配置的IP地址。

    4. 配置默认网关:使用`route`命令或`ip route add`命令来配置默认网关,例如`route add default gw 192.168.0.1`或`ip route add default via 192.168.0.1`。其中,将`192.168.0.1`替换为要配置的默认网关的IP地址。

    5. 启用网络接口:使用`ifup`命令或`ifconfig`命令来启用已配置的网络接口,例如`ifup eth0`。

    6. 验证配置:使用`ifconfig`命令或`ip addr`命令来查看已配置的网络接口的IP地址和状态。

    此外,还可以使用其他一些命令来配置其他网络参数,如DNS服务器、IP转发等。例如,可以使用`vi`或`nano`等文本编辑器编辑`/etc/resolv.conf`文件来配置DNS服务器。可以使用`sysctl`命令来配置IP转发,如`sysctl net.ipv4.ip_forward=1`。

    需要注意的是,以上命令在不同的Linux发行版中可能有所不同,确保了解所使用发行版的特定命令和配置文件路径。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ux通过命令配置IP地址是非常常见的操作,下面我将介绍一种常用的方式。请注意,下面的操作均需在root权限下进行。

    步骤一:查看当前网络配置信息
    首先,需要查看当前系统的网络配置信息,包括网络接口名称、IP地址、子网掩码、网关等。可以使用以下命令来查看当前网络配置信息:

    “`
    $ ifconfig
    “`

    该命令会列出当前系统所有的网络接口及其配置信息。

    步骤二:编辑网络配置文件
    接下来,我们需要编辑网络接口的配置文件,以设置正确的IP地址。在大多数Linux发行版中,网络配置文件的路径为`/etc/network/interfaces`。

    可以使用任何文本编辑器打开该配置文件,例如vi或nano:

    “`
    $ sudo vi /etc/network/interfaces
    “`

    在文件中找到你想要配置的网络接口,例如eth0,然后编辑它的配置信息。以下是一个示例配置:

    “`
    iface eth0 inet static
    address 192.168.1.100
    netmask 255.255.255.0
    gateway 192.168.1.1
    “`

    在上面的示例中,我们将eth0配置为静态IP地址,IP地址为192.168.1.100,子网掩码为255.255.255.0,网关为192.168.1.1。根据你的网络环境和需求,你可以根据需要修改这些值。

    步骤三:重启网络服务
    完成网络配置后,需要重启网络服务,使更改生效。可以使用以下命令重启网络服务:

    “`
    $ sudo /etc/init.d/networking restart
    “`

    这将重新启动网络服务并应用新的网络配置。

    步骤四:确认IP地址配置成功
    最后,我们可以再次运行ifconfig命令来确认新的IP地址配置是否生效。如果一切顺利,你应该能够看到你刚刚配置的IP地址。

    总结
    通过以上步骤,我们可以通过命令行来配置Linux系统的IP地址。记住,在编辑网络配置文件之前,最好备份一份配置文件,以防出现错误。另外,每个Linux发行版可能有稍微不同的配置文件路径和网络服务管理方式,所以确保根据你使用的发行版做相应的调整。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部